Esempio n. 1
0
 private string RenderTemplate(List <Service> services)
 {
     using (
         StreamReader template = new StreamReader(new FileStream("Resources\\services.cottle", FileMode.Open),
                                                  Encoding.UTF8))
     {
         try
         {
             Document document = new Document(template);
             Scope    scope    = new Scope();
             CommonFunctions.Assign(scope);
             scope["services"] = new ReflectionValue(services);
             return(document.Render(scope));
         }
         catch (Exception)
         {
             Console.WriteLine("Error rendering template");
         }
     }
     return("Error rendering template");
 }